Just a little background information on the Sekai Ichi Hatsukoi series before I start my babbling...

Sekai Ichi Hatsukoi is a series by Nakamura Shungiku which revolves around the lives of characters connected with a publishing company. It's actually set in the same world as Junjou Romantica, since various characters make cameos, such as the director(?) of the company that Usami works at, the father of Misaki's sempai, and although Usami himself doesn't make an appearance, the books he writes does. The series is actually split into two mediums - one is a manga written and drawn by Nakamura-sensei called Sekai Ichi Hatsukoi ~Onodera Ritsu no Baai~, and the other is a novel series called Sekai Ichi Hatsukoi ~Yoshino Chiaki no Baai~, which is illustrated by Nakamura-sensei but written by Fujisaki Miyako, the person who also writes the Junai Romantica/Egoist novels.
